Annual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io for Finexia Financial Group Ltd (2012–2024)
Year-by-year debt coverage analysis for Finexia Financial Group Ltd. For market capitalisation and broader financial context, see market value of Finexia Financial Group Ltd.
| Year | CF-to-Debt Ratio | Operating CF (AUD) | Total Liabilities |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| -0.01x | AU$-1.81 Million | AU$134.96 Million | ▼ -147.6% |
| 2023 | 0.03x | AU$2.71 Million | AU$96.64 Million | ▲ +24.3% |
| 2022 | 0.02x | AU$1.38 Million | AU$61.10 Million | ▼ -78.3% |
| 2021 | 0.10x | AU$4.62 Million | AU$44.24 Million | ▲ +466.0% |
| 2020 | 0.02x | AU$350.20K | AU$19.00 Million | ▲ +112.0% |
| 2019 | -0.15x | AU$-222.25K | AU$1.44 Million | ▲ +40.2% |
| 2018 | -0.26x | AU$-353.39K | AU$1.37 Million | ▲ +95.1% |
| 2017 | -5.29x | AU$-873.20K | AU$165.00K | ▼ -591.0% |
| 2016 | -0.77x | AU$-2.06 Million | AU$2.69 Million | ▼ -106.3% |
| 2015 | -0.37x | AU$-1.17 Million | AU$3.16 Million | ▼ -89.6% |
| 2014 | -0.20x | AU$-479.90K | AU$2.45 Million | ▲ +50.1% |
| 2013 | -0.39x | AU$-53.54K | AU$136.41K | ▲ +8.7% |
| 2012 | -0.43x | AU$-6.45K | AU$15.00K | — |
